Axis bug. Still active on live to my knowledge as it was part of the core engine and couldn't be fixed.
Whenever you travel on 2 or more axis the speeds all get added together and you move faster than you should. Most people used it unknowingly the few couple weeks bunny hopping repeatedly to escape mobs. Then stamina got "altered" in a patch as a bandaid for the problem. Some people just started walking diagonally with mouselook on and found it worked too. It works in other games as well. | ||
